Thermoresponsive self-assembly of short elastin-like polypentapeptides and their poly(ethylene glycol) derivatives.

Abstract

Short polypeptides with four pentad repeats, (VPGVG)(4) and (VPAVG)(4), were synthesised by manual fluorenylmethoxycarbonyl/tert-butyl (Fmoc/t-Bu) solid phase peptide synthesis using a convergent approach. In the next step, the peptides were coupled via their N-terminus with activated semi-telechelic poly(ethylene glycol) O-(N-Fmoc-2-aminoethyl)-O'-(2-carboxyethyl)undeca(ethylene glycol) (Fmoc-PEG-COOH) to yield monodisperse Fmoc-PEG-peptide diblock copolymer. Both the presence of the terminal hydrophobic Fmoc group and the hydrophilic PEG chain in the copolymers were shown to play a crucial role in their self-associative behaviour, leading to reversible formation of supramolecular thermoresponsive assemblies. The peptides and their PEG derivatives were characterised by HPLC, NMR and MALDI-TOF MS. The associative behaviour of the peptides and their PEG derivatives was studied by dynamic light scattering, MAS NMR and phase contrast microscopy. [image: see text]
